Garage Door Not Opening? Common Causes and Solutions
A garage door that won’t open or close can disrupt your routine and pose a safety or security issue. The problem could be as simple as a remote-control issue or as complex as a broken spring, a damaged cable, a faulty opener, a misaligned sensor, or an off-track door.

Test the power and the garage door remote.
First, make sure the opener has power. Ensure that the power cord is plugged in and check the electrical panel for a tripped breaker.

Safety Sensor Inspection
Newer garage door openers have sensors located near the bottom of the tracks. If the sensors become blocked, dirty or out of alignment, the door may not close or may reverse immediately.
Clear the doorway of objects, clean the sensor lenses carefully and check that both indicator lights are on. Do not skip over the sensors; they are an important safety feature.
Look for a broken spring or cable.
The weight of the garage doors and the controlled movement is carried by the springs and cables. Signs of a damaged component include loud snapping sounds, uneven movement or a door that feels heavier than usual.
If a cable is broken or frayed, don’t operate the door. DoorMaster recommends that customers do not use a garage door with a broken cable as it can be hazardous.
Trained technicians should do spring and cable repairs because these components are under a lot of tension.
Check to see if the door is off the Track.
If the tracks are bent, the rollers are damaged, or there has been an impact, the door may be uneven or come away from the track. Do not force the opener or shove the door back into place. If continued to be operated, the damage could increase, or the door could fall.
